Born 1979, American Artist, b. Fort Worth, TX. Adam Johnson has always had an interest in art from the very beginning. At the age of fifteen he moved from Fort Worth to Port Aransas, TX. Then at seventeen he went to The Art Institute of Houston where he studied computer animation and traditional art. Since completing his formal training he pursued his art in Fort Worth, TX, Denver, CO, and Philadelphia, PA, before returning to Port Aransas in 2006. During this time he practiced his art as a graphic artist, web designer, and art director. Mr. Johnson's art subjects include surfing, oceanscapes, landscapes, and nature.
